Output 3e0d579f486512bde2379fda08e8bf2a296bffaa682f01f9c4e273f7f9c9e1ea:18

value
1191983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b178c590c61871e73de01a5d0cfdba202166f05b OP_EQUAL
address
3HsQCs9M1CzgGYEkn4u2skUCU54kvwyR2e
transaction
3e0d579f486512bde2379fda08e8bf2a296bffaa682f01f9c4e273f7f9c9e1ea
spent
true